Hi everybody i am new to the forum i have a problem with my 2014 Santa FE Sport it was left to me when my dad passed away it has 10250 miles on it and when i drive it down the road it has a lot of Vibration in it . It starts at 20mph and it is bad at 40mph and it not as bad at 60mph but it is still there the inside mirror vibrats also it has the stock Aluminum Wheels on it and 235/65-17 Kumho tires on it also the passenger set vibrats also and the tires have be balanced 3 times dose anybody else have this problem do not want to trade it ???:|

In Canada my 2015 came with Continental CrossContactLX tires on the 17" wheels . . and the ride is very smooth and quiet. My first st would be a good tire shop to get their opinion from a test drive. It's always possible a rotation and proper balancing might solve the problem? If you've seen bad reports for the Kuhmo's on this vehicle then I'd say a new set of different tires stands a good chance of correcting your problem and I know the Conti's are good on the SFS. If it doesn't fix it completely, at least you've eliminated tires as a possible contributor. Iyou could go for a new set of tires and sell your Kuhmo's with only 10,000 on them on FleaBay.

2014 Santa FE Sport with only 10k miles? I just replaced my stock rock-hard Kumo's with Michelin touring, night and day with the ride, but that included alignment at a reputable dealer with an experienced crew (not my local Hyundai stealership). $$$
